uvær
Norwegian Bokmål edit
Etymology edit
From Old Norse úveðr, óveðr, from Proto-Germanic *unwedrą, equivalent to u- + vær; compare with German Unwetter and English unweather.
Noun edit
uvær n (definite singular uværet, indefinite plural uvær, definite plural uværa or uværene)
